An exciting new opportunity for an Acquisition Specialist with a well-known UK Telecoms Infrastructure company. This is a 12 month contract position that will be based in Theale, Reading with hybrid working.

The main purpose of role

To secure planning permission and the best possible rights with landlords to deploy a defined group of new and existing telecom sites. To work with the Operator regional teams to achieve the optimum site solution in terms of time, cost & quality.

Key Responsibilities

  • To deliver owned acquisition activities across a defined group of sites to achieve the client & Shareholder targets through effective management of the Acquisition Agents, Solicitors & 3rd party suppliers.
  • To be aware of & manage dependencies on the client and Operator regional teams across a defined group of sites through planning, tracking & reporting to ensure regional acquisition targets are achieved.
  • To deliver target lease terms on individual sites by applying agreed standards, policies & expertise and escalating exceptions to enable the business to make informed decisions
  • Apply acquisition & property expertise to support & validate the work of the Acquisition Agents, Solicitors & 3rd party suppliers to ensure site specific issues are addressed
  • Build & maintain effective working relationships with the client and Operator regional teams and Demand, Property & Finance teams to ensure policy is understood & applied consistently and improve certainty that objectives will be achieved by setting realistic expectations, delivering on commitments & effective communication
  • To proactively surface and record all risk, issues & dependencies, subsequently managing their mitigation and resolution or escalating those that cannot be solved
  • To support and contribute actively to health and safety, environmental, business continuity and information security arrangements that meets our obligations to our customers
